Subject: Posting Guidelines
Date: 28 Jun 91 01:58:52 GMT


New readers are always joining Paranet. 

For their benefit, allow me to review the rules of posting which we ask
all our users to adopt: 


                   ******* PARANET ECHO POLICIES ********

The following are guidelines  for the operation of the Paranet Echos on 
member boards. Please take a moment to read (and understand) these 
policies. If we'll adopt these attitudes, we'll have a more polite, 
effective network. 

1. No anonymous messages may be posted on the network.   Some Paranet BBS's 
   allow users to use "handles", and  USENET  users  have no opportunity to
   place their names in the "From" field. If a user uses a handle, then all
   posts to  Paranet  Echos must be signed at the  end of the message using
   the user's REAL NAME. In  the  case  of  USENET  posts, it would help to
   place the  ADDRESSEE's REAL NAME in the subject field. It is the respon-
   sibility of the Sysop of each Paranet Node to enforce this  requirement,
   either  by  reviewing  all  messages  before  release, or by disallowing
   Paranet access to users using handles. 

2. Personal Attacks  are *NOT* allowed in the Net. In any echo dealing with 
   issues as emotional as those with which we deal it is a matter of course 
   that  the validity of testimony on the part of certain individuals  will 
   be  called into question.  It is important,  however,  to remember  that 
   *ALL* parties are to be treated with respect.  If you wish to question a 
   person's validity, state your reservations AS YOUR OPINION. For example: 
   "John  Doe  is  a totally unreliable witness"  could leave  you  legally 
   vulnerable.  "I BELIEVE John Doe to be a totally unreliable witness"  is 
   much better,  especially if you can add "because...".  Please be careful 
   how  you  judge  the  parties  involved,  and  attempt  to  defend  your 
   contentions. 

3. Any user who is found to have knowingly and deliberately posted false or 
   misleading  information  regarding  the  activities of the United States 
   Government,  its intelligence  agencies and/or operatives,  with respect 
   to the investigation of UFOs or other related matters,  will  be  locked
   out  of  the  network  immediately   and  permanently,  and  their  name
   circulated to other UFO investigatory groups. 

3.1 Since  Paranet  echos are exported to a number of countries  around the
   world, it should be noted that  Federal Law  prohibits the revelation of
   "National Secrets" to "Foreign Governments".   For this reason,  we must
   insist that material which might violate the National Secrets Act not be
   posted in the echos. All sensitive material believed to be of legitimate
   interest to Paranet researches should be delievered via  NETMAIL to Mike
   Corbin at Paranet Administration for review and subsequent release.

4. Direct Flames  are  best posted elsewhere. They will not be tolerated in 
   the echos.

5. References  should be included if required for clarity.  Some users tend 
   to  copy  the  entirity of previous messages  before  responding,  while 
   others  never  quote anything and simply make  comments  about  previous 
   posts.   You  should remember that many boards don't hold  all  messages 
   forever.  Quote (if your software  allows it)  or  at  least  paraphrase 
   (write  a  simple summary of) the content  of  the message you refer to.  
   Please  DO NOT  quote the  entire  message,  as this is just expense for 
   all boards concerned.  Quote only the germaine material. 

6. Please make  all  messages conform to the specified content of the  Echo 
   Area in which you are posting.  Putting  the  messages in the right pile
   makes it MUCH easier to make sense out of the stacks of messages. 
   
7. Enforcement.  Users who violate these guidelines will  be advised of the 
   lapse by the Echo Moderator. After three violation notices,  the user is 
   to be locked out of Paranet areas by the sysop.  A FIRST lockout will be 
   for  THIRTY DAYS.  A  SECOND lockout will be for NINETY days.  The THIRD 
   lockout  will  be PERMANENT.  Sysops who refuse to lock out  troublesome 
   users  can be dropped from the net by the Paranet Administrator.   Users 
   who  believe  the Moderator has been unfair in requesting a lockout  can 
   request  that  their Sysop plead their case in the Sysop Echo.  In  such 
   cases,  ALL net Sysops will be asked to vote on the matter.  Vote of the 
   net is binding on all concerned.

     In a recent 'research study' done by UTMB Neuropsychology Galveston on the
effects of migrane headaches upon lifestyle, a few CURIOUS questions arose, 
being that my wife was a participant, she was able to relay this information to 
me.  (She had recently been scheduled for a Cat Scan to diagnose unusual 
migrane headaches)
  The questionairres were in general, mostly generic, but the following 
questions were asked that make me feel *perhaps* something more is being 
studied than just headaches...
  1) Have you ever felt you were being watched?
next question was a clincher...
  2) Do you believe in Extraterrestrial life?

I see little reason that such questions should be included in a purely 
scientific study unless the medical profession has turned 180 degrees and 
suddenly believes in extraterrestrials...

  (still waiting for the results of the Cat-Scan... although I wonder if we'll 
get to see what was actually taken, or not...)
